Taxonomic Classification

Rank Assam Macaque Brown Eared-Pheasant
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Aves (Birds)
Order Primates (Primates) Galliformes (Galliformes)
Family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) Phasianidae
Genus Macaca Crossoptilon
Species Macaca assamensis Crossoptilon mantchuricum

Evolutionary Relationship

Assam Macaque and Brown Eared-Pheasant share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
